Man in critical condition following collision
Date published: 01 June 2010
A man is in a critical condition in hospital after a collision in Rochdale.
Just before 12.20am on Saturday (29 May 2010), a Renault Clio collided with a pedestrian on St Mary's Gate, Rochdale, just past the junction with Whitworth Road.
The 30-year-old man was taken to hospital suffering serious head injuries and he remains in a critical condition.
The driver of the Clio was not injured.
The road was closed for a short time while the incident was dealt with.
